The IE Leadership & Foresight Hub begins in February and ends in Novembre 2024. Given that the participants are senior executives with busy schedules, the activity is concentrated in one monthly session at IE Tower in Madrid, on the first Wednesday of each month, from 2:30 p.m. to 6:30 p.m. Each session will address a specific current business topic. There will be presentations from expert specialists, and the work will be divided into three main blocks: New Paradigms, Open Debate, and Anchoring for 2024.
The IE Leadership & Foresight Hub is not designed in the same way as a regular program. Rather than sticking to specific content, sessions will encourage the exchange of ideas based on a series of recommended materials that participants will be asked to read beforehand. The different leaders and experts participating in the program will be split into groups to collaborate on a wide range of activities. These group dynamics are designed to encourage cooperation and diversity of perspectives, so teams will be comprised of participants from all backgrounds, sectors, and ages.
The aim of the program is to seek opportunities and design strategies that, while created with sights set on the future, can be implemented now in companies· day-to-day operations. Various "jam sessions" are organized to encourage learning and co creation, with innovation, vision, and creativity as key pillars.
In addition to attending monthly sessions, participants can also take part in two optional, immersive "Bootcamps” where they will have the opportunity to explore new projects. The first of these will be held at the Segovia campus, and the second at IE Tower in Madrid.
